Do I need to soak mung beans before cooking?

Do you need to soak mung beans? No! Mung beans are small and quick to cook compared to other beans like black beans or chickpeas, so no soaking is required before cooking them.

How long does it take to cook mung beans?

Rinse beans before cooking. Place 1 cup beans in a large pot with 3 cups water and 1 tsp salt. Bring to a boil, then reduce to a simmer, cover and cook until tender, about 30 minutes; drain well.

How do you know when mung beans are cooked?

Set stove dial to high and bring pot to a boil uncovered. Lower heat to medium low and simmer for 45 minutes to an hour uncovered stirring occasionally. You’ll know it’s done when most of the water has dried up and the beans look puffy.

Are Mungbeans healthy?

Mung beans are high in nutrients and antioxidants, which may provide health benefits. In fact, they may protect against heat stroke, aid digestive health, promote weight loss and lower “bad” LDL cholesterol, blood pressure and blood sugar levels.

Can you over Soak mung beans?

Hot water may cause the beans to sour. Beans soaked longer than 12 hours can absorb too much water and lose their characteristic texture and flavor. Why are my beans still hard after cooking?

Beans that have been stored for over 12 months or in unfavorable conditions may never soften. Hard water may also cause hard beans. If the cooked beans still seem tough, add a 1/4 teaspoon sodium bicarbonate (baking soda) for each pound of beans to increase tenderness.

How long does it take to cook beans after soaking?

Drain soaked beans and transfer to a large pot. Cover by 2 inches with cold water, add onion and bay leaves and bring to a boil; skim off and discard any foam on the surface. Reduce heat, cover and simmer, gently stirring occasionally, until beans are tender, 1 to 1 1/2 hours.

How long do you have to soak beans before cooking?

To soak beans the traditional way, cover them with water by 2 inches, add 2 tablespoons coarse kosher salt (or 1 tablespoon fine salt) per pound of beans, and let them soak for at least 4 hours or up to 12 hours. Drain them and rinse before using.
